Abstract

A highly enantioselective domino reaction of α,β-unsaturated aldehydes and 4-acetyl-5-oxohexanal catalyzed by a chiral secondary amine catalyst has been developed, providing an efficient synthetic approach for the synthesis of densely functionalized chiral cyclohexene derivatives with high yields (up to 96%) and enantioselectivities (up to 97% ee) under mild conditions.
